DanaNM replied to the topic Pls help! Kind of bonded, but still territorial! in the forum BONDING 4 years, 10 months ago
Oh, I was going to say, what would happen if you reduced the pen size a bit, so the area they were in was ALL pee pads and hay. Like not so small that they don’t have room to move, but small enough that he doesn’t try to “claim” the hay pile?

DanaNM replied to the topic Pls help! Kind of bonded, but still territorial! in the forum BONDING 4 years, 10 months ago
They look very cute together!
Do you think the couch could be making them a bit more territorial if they are familiar from your old place?
Perhaps just having two litter boxes in different areas would help. And yes, I think having lower sides on the boxes should help too.

Oreo’s Mom replied to the topic Hello everyone! First time bunny owner. in the forum WELCOME ! 4 years, 10 months ago
Her pen is set up in our main living area. And someone is always talking to her or interacting with her. She has her paper towel rolls in there along with some toilet paper rolls I filled with hay and folded the ends closed. I also have willow sticks, a sea grass ball and some willow balls in there.
